Etymology[edit]

catheter +‎ -ization

Noun[edit]

catheterization (countable and uncountable, plural catheterizations)

  1. The procedure of introducing a catheter.
    Since the development of fiber optics, treatments utilizing catheterization have replaced some former surgical procedures.
